What I Looked for Before Buying
When I started shopping, I focused on a few important things. I wanted a key that fit my specific John Deere model, worked smoothly in the ignition, and was made with durable materials. I also checked whether the key was an original OEM part or a compatible aftermarket option. That helped me decide what would give me the best value for my money.
Compatibility Matters Most
One thing I learned quickly is that not every John Deere key fits every machine. I made sure to check the model number of my equipment before ordering anything. Some keys are designed for tractors, while others work with lawn mowers, Gators, or compact utility vehicles. Matching the key to my machine was the most important step.
OEM vs Aftermarket Keys
I compared OEM and aftermarket replacement keys before making my choice. OEM keys gave me peace of mind because they are made to match John Deere specifications. Aftermarket keys were often cheaper, and some worked just as well, but I paid close attention to reviews and product details. For me, the right choice depended on whether I wanted guaranteed fit or a lower price.
Material and Build Quality
I preferred a key that felt sturdy in my hand. A replacement key should not bend easily or wear down after a few uses. I looked for solid metal construction and a design that could handle regular use. Since I use my equipment outdoors, I wanted something reliable and long-lasting.
